New Delhi: Former High Commissioner to India Muazzem Ali and 1971 War Heroes Colonel Quazi Sajjad Ali Zahir will be the first citizen of Bangladesh to be respected with one of the highest civilian awards in India on Monday Padma, on Monday.
Muezzem Ali will be respected annually at a function here where other recipients named in January will also receive their awards.
India and Bangladesh celebrate the 50th anniversary of the liberation of Bangladesh and 50th year of diplomatic bonds with India and the centenary of Sheikh Mujibur Rehman.
Vijay Diawas celebration on December 16 can see a high-level visit from India.
The Bangladesh media report suggested that President Ram Nath Kovind might travel to Bangladesh for that opportunity.
The sources of the Indian government said there was no clarity about the President’s schedule.
The celebration has continued, especially in virtual mode during a pandemic, although both parties can see in-person events in the coming weeks.
December 6 is being celebrated as a maitri dijwak between the two countries.
This year this opportunity will be celebrated in the US, England, Thailand among 18 other countries with significant Indian Bangladesh and Diaspora.
